The nslookup system test checks the count of resolved addresses in the CNAME tests using a 'grep' match on the hostname, and ignoring lines containing the 'canonical name' string. In order to protect the check from intermittent failures like the 'address in use' warning message, which then automatically resolves after a retry, edit the 'grep' matching string to also ignore the comments (as the mentioned warning message is a comment which contains the hostname).
